| LEAD DESIGNER AND CEO: CAELIN GABRIEL Within the audio-video industry, there is no engineer with a more complete understanding of the scientific tenets critical to signal isolation and current delivery. While in college, Caelin Gabriel’s performance in the physical sciences attracted the attention of the US military. Gabriel was recruited and selected for training at a secret Navy cadre, and was subsequently assigned to the Military division of the National Security Agency. The NSA is the governmental information-gathering agency, with the world's most elaborate high-speed computers and signal decoding equipment. Gabriel was involved in the extensive R&D of ultra-sensitive data acquisition systems. These systems were designed to detect extremely low-level signals that required an outside-the-box approach to signal and noise-isolation. Equipment used by Gabriel and the team of NSA scientists could lock onto a correlated signal virtually obscured by random noise -- a feat believed impossible by engineers using commercial electronics of that era. |
||||||
| Subsequent to his military career, Gabriel became involved in the computer industry during the early Internet days under DARPA, working on network architecture. Later, he became involved with the development of high-speed networking devices like the 1GB/s fibre-channel interface and the present 100MB/s and 1GB/s Ethernet devices. Working with super-high-speed circuits wreaks havoc with textbook engineering school truisms. One cannot assume that wire has zero resistance, inductance or relative capacitance. In fact, Gabriel learned that whether a circuit works at all may well depend on the quality of connectors, interfaces and the buss system architecture. These unique work related experiences at the highest levels of government and computer science led Caelin Gabriel to develop a series of fundamental precepts for the patented technologies and custom-designed parts that form the cornerstone of Shunyata Research products. |
